GPS technology has revolutionized precise positioning. It leverages a global network of satellites to transmit signals that receivers on Earth use to determine their location. By analyzing the reception of these signals from get more info multiple satellites, GPS systems can calculate a user's latitude, longitude, and altitude with remarkable resolution. This feature has wide-ranging applications in navigation, delivery, geospatial mapping, and many other fields. GPS technology continues to evolve, with ongoing efforts to refine its precision and broadening its range of applications.

Beyond Navigation: Exploring the Potential of GPS Geofencing

GPS geofencing, once recognized for its application in navigation, is rapidly growing into a versatile tool with implications spanning multiple industries. This technology allows us to set virtual boundaries around specific locations, triggering actions when devices exit these defined areas.

From enhancing marketing campaigns to automating logistics, geofencing offers a range of unique solutions. It can be utilized to monitor assets, strengthen security systems, and even customize user experiences.

As geofencing technology continues to develop, its potential for disrupting various sectors is only just beginning to be explored.

The Future of Location Tracking: Advances in GPS Géolocalisation

The realm of location tracking is on the cusp of a transformation, driven by significant advances in Global Positioning System (GPS) technology and related geospatial solutions. Emerging applications leverage the enhanced accuracy and reliability of GPS, blurring the lines between the physical and digital worlds.

  • Cellular networks are increasingly integrated with GPS to provide persistent location updates even in areas where traditional GPS signals may be weak.
  • Indoor positioning systems are becoming commonplace, utilizing technologies like Bluetooth beacons and ultrasound to pinpoint locations within buildings and confined environments.
  • Deep learning algorithms are utilized to process GPS data, detecting patterns and trends that can provide valuable insights about user behavior, mobility.

As a result, the future of location tracking holds immense potential for domains ranging from logistics to environmental monitoring, with far-reaching implications for our daily lives and the way we interact with the world.
